The European Union attaches great importance to nuclear safety and the environment and, consequently, understands the Republic of Korea's concerns over Taiwanese intentions to ship 60,000 barrels of low-level nuclear waste from Taiwan for storage in the Democratic People's Republic of Korea.

The European Union points out that the transport and storage of such radioactive waste should take place in full respect of international safety standards and IAEA guidelines pertaining to the export, transport and disposal of nuclear waste, including low-level waste.

The European Union holds that, although neither DPRK nor Taiwan are members of the IAEA, nevertheless the IAEA should be invited to advise on and, possibly, monitor compliance with above guidelines in this particular case.
